Kristian Woolf critical of referee [1]
Monday, November 27, 2017 - 19:56
In a post-match conference following the game, Kristian Woolf told reporters that he was puzzled at why Matt Cecchin did not consult a video referee before making the ruling.
Kristian Woolf stated, "I just can't believe we don't have a look at that (consult the video referee), the game is on the line, it's the last play of the game.”
"What I don't understand with that one, when you look at some of the other tries, the first try that England scored and Andrew Fifita looks like he gets his arm underneath and we look at that as many times as we possibly can."
Concerning his team’s performance, Woolf said his team had failed to take the opportunities they created during the game.
"We had three or four opportunities well before that last 10 or 15 minutes and for whatever reason tonight, opportunities we have taken in past games, we just weren't able to take," Woolf said.
"We just didn't quite get there tonight with a couple of opportunities we created."
“I thought we certainly did enough to win that game at different times, our execution was just a little bit off when it counted."
“I thought for very, very long periods we were on top of that game. We were a little bit ill-disciplined when we needed to be better, that gave England field position at times.
